The Evolution of Luxury in China: A New Mindset

The timing of this exhibition is pivotal for Loro Piana in China. Despite market fluctuations, the brand continues to thrive, signaling its strong foothold in the Chinese luxury market. A recent Bain & Company study sheds light on the shifting behavior of Chinese consumers, who are increasingly drawn to understated elegance, a preference that aligns perfectly with Loro Piana’s values.

This transition toward refined, subtle products resonates deeply with the more sophisticated Chinese audience, who favor a brand that not only embodies quality but also timelessness and exclusivity. Loro Piana stands out as a leader in the quiet luxury trend, which is gaining traction in China.

A Long-Term Strategy: VIC Salons and Expansion into Tier 2 Cities

Loro Piana is not just focused on short-term visibility. Its expansion into Tier 2 cities in China and the launch of its VIC (Very Important Client) salons signal a strategic focus on exclusivity and creating authentic, deep relationships with its clients. These private salons are a way for Loro Piana to cultivate long-lasting emotional bonds with its most loyal customers, far from the mass-market logic of flashy marketing and broad accessibility.

The goal is not only to increase the brand’s visibility in the short term but to build long-term brand equity based on client experience and exclusivity. This model of privileged relationships allows Loro Piana to focus on creating lasting value by offering personalized experiences that go beyond a simple commercial transaction.
